👨💻
Este é projeto se baseia em alguns fluxos de manutenções de dados de desenvolvedores e de níveis relacionados aos desenvolvedores, seguido o princípio de API REST com os métodos (GET, POST, PUT/PATCH e DELETE).
Tecnologia | Versão | Link para Instalação |
---|---|---|
GIT | ^2.25.1 | 👉 Acessar |
Make | ^4.2.1 | 👉 Acessar |
Docker | ^20.10.12 | 👉 Acessar |
Docker Compose | ^1.29.2 | 👉 Acessar |
Node.js | ^16.14.0 | 👉 Acessar |
Yarn | ^1.22.11 | 👉 Acessar |
-
Clone o repositório:
# SSH $ [email protected]:lucasoliveiraw00/developer-api-server.git
-
Gere o arquivo .env:
Preencher o arquivo .env com os dados de ambiente de desenvolvimento.
$ cp .env.example .env
-
Realize o build do projeto:
$ make build
-
Execute as configurações do setup:
$ make setup
-
Iniciar o projeto:
$ make up
Tecnologia | Versão | Link para Instalação |
---|---|---|
GIT | ^2.25.1 | 👉 Acessar |
Make | ^4.2.1 | 👉 Acessar |
Docker | ^20.10.12 | 👉 Acessar |
Docker Compose | ^1.29.2 | 👉 Acessar |
-
Clone o repositório:
# SSH $ [email protected]:lucasoliveiraw00/developer-api-server.git
-
Gere o arquivo .env:
Preencher o arquivo .env com os dados de ambiente de produção.
$ cp .env.example .env
-
Realize o build do projeto:
$ make build
-
Execute as configurações do setup:
$ make setup
-
Iniciar o projeto:
$ make up
- ⚡️ AdonisJS 5
- 💫 TypeScript
- 🐶 Husky
- 📄 Commitizen
- 🚓 Commitlint
- 📏 ESLint
- ⚙️ EditorConfig
- 💖 Prettier
- 🚫 Lint Staged